- The distance between Legaspi, Philippines and Nanchang, China is approximately 1,898 km or 1,180 mi.
- To reach Legaspi in this distance one would set out from Nanchang bearing 153.2° or SSE and follow the great circles arc to approach Legaspi bearing 156° or SSE .
- Legaspi has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Nanchang has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Legaspi is in or near the subtropical wet forest biome whereas Nanchang is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 9.6 °C (17.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 21.5 °C (38.7°F) less in Legaspi.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1808.3 mm (71.2 in) more which is equivalent to 1808.3 l/m² (44.38 US gal/ft²) or 18,083,000 l/ha (1,933,193 US gal/ac) more. About 2 1/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 11.1° higher in Legaspi than in Nanchang.
